
Sensors
Sensors are essential components of electronic and automation systems that enable the measurement, detection, and conversion of physical signals into electrical data. They allow monitoring of temperature, humidity, pressure, motion, magnetic fields, proximity, and many other environmental parameters. With their help, process automation, device protection, environmental condition analysis, and real-time control become possible
How Do Sensors Work?
Sensors convert physical quantities into analog or digital signals, which can be processed by electronic circuits. With modern communication interfaces such as I²C, SPI, UART, PWM, or analog outputs, sensors can be easily integrated into embedded systems, microcontrollers (e.g., Arduino, Raspberry Pi, ESP32), and PLCs.
Key Sensor Parameters
✔ Measurement range – defines the minimum and maximum values the sensor can detect
✔ Accuracy – the higher the precision, the better the measurement quality
✔ Response time – crucial in real-time systems
✔ Communication interface – analog (voltage, current) or digital (I²C, SPI, UART)
✔ Power consumption – essential for IoT and battery-powered devices
✔ Environmental resistance – water resistance, temperature range, EMI immunity
Applications of Sensors
Sensors are widely used in various fields of technology:
✔ Industrial automation – process monitoring, machine control
✔ Smart home & IoT – lighting, HVAC, security systems
✔ Automotive – tire pressure monitoring (TPMS), obstacle detection, ABS systems
✔ Medical & biotech – heart rate, temperature measurement, chemical analysis
✔ Consumer electronics – smartphones, wearables, smartwatches, audio devices
✔ Robotics – navigation, obstacle avoidance, AI systems
✔ Security systems – motion detection, smoke and gas sensors, intrusion alarms
